Javascript学习笔记之 对象篇(三) : hasOwnProperty

-
判断一个属性是定义在对象本身而不是继承自原型链,我们需要使用从 Object.prototype 继承而来的 hasOwnProperty 方法。hasOwnProperty 方法是 Javascript 中唯一一个处理对象属性而不会往上遍历原型链的。
-
2020-10-25
42KB
理解JAVASCRIPT中hasOwnProperty()的作用
2020-12-09JavaScript中hasOwnProperty函数方法是返回一个布尔值,指出一个对象是否具有指定名称的属性。 hasOwnProperty()使用方法: object.hasOwnProperty
65KB
《JavaScript高级程序设计》阅读笔记(三) ECMAScript中的引用类型
2020-12-092.8 引用类型 1、Object类 ECMAScript中的所有类都是由Object类继承而来。 Object类具有下列属性: Constructor:对创建对象的函数的引用(指针),对
38KB
JavaScript hasOwnProperty() 函数实例详解
2020-12-10hasOwnProperty()函数用于指示一个对象自身(不包括原型链)是否具有指定名称的属性。如果有,返回true,否则返回false。 该方法属于Object对象,由于所有的对象都”继承”了Obj
49KB
JavaScript中in和hasOwnProperty区别详解
2020-10-19in操作符只要通过对象能访问到属性就返回true。hasOwnProperty()只在属性存在于实例中时才返回true。下面通过本文给大家分享JavaScript中in和hasOwnProperty区
32KB
JavaScript isPrototypeOf和hasOwnProperty使用区别
2020-10-29JavaScript isPrototypeOf和hasOwnProperty的使用技巧,需要的朋友的朋友可以参考下。
50KB
Javascript中的for in循环和hasOwnProperty结合使用
2020-10-27当检测某个对象是否拥有某个属性时,hasOwnProperty 是唯一可以完成这一任务的方法,在 for in 循环时,建议增加 hasOwnProperty 进行判断,可以有效避免扩展本地原型而引起
29KB
详谈js使用in和hasOwnProperty获取对象属性的区别
2020-11-28in判断的是对象的所有属性,包括对象实例及其原型的属性; 而hasOwnProperty则是判断对象实例的是否具有某个属性。 示例代码: function Person(){ } Person.pro
67KB
JS面向对象(3)之Object类,静态属性,闭包,私有属性, call和apply的使用,继承的三种实现方法
2020-11-221.Object类 在JS中,Object是所有类的基类,使用Object类来创建自定义对象时,可以无需定义构造函数(constructor,prototype,hasOwnProperty(prop
19KB
javascript计算对象长度的方法
2020-11-27计算对象的长度,即获取对象属性的个数,具体如下 方法一:通过for in 遍历对象,并通过hasOwnProperty判断是否是对象自身可枚举的属性 var obj = {"c1":1,"c2":2}
41KB
javascript中hasOwnProperty() 方法使用指南
2020-10-24主要详细介绍了javascript中hasOwnProperty() 方法使用指南,非常的全面,推荐给有需要的小伙伴参考下。
23KB
Javascript hasOwnProperty 方法 & in 关键字
2020-10-30hasOwnProperty :如果 object 具有指定名称的属性,那么方法返回 true;反之则返回 false。
37KB
利用hasOwnProperty给数组去重的面试题分享
2020-12-10hasOwnProperty hasOwnProperty是javascript中用于检测对象是否包含某个属性的方法,返回一个布尔值。 var o = { a: 1}; console.log(o.h
137KB
JavaScript知识点总结(十一)之js中的Object类详解
2020-11-22JavaScript中的Object对象,是JS中所有对象的基类,也就是说JS中的所有对象都是由Object对象衍生的。Object对象主要用于将任意数据封装成对象形式。 一、Object类介绍
41KB
浅析JavaScript中的对象类型Object
2020-11-26ECMAScript中的对象其实就是一组数据和功能的集合。 ECMAScript中Object是所有对象的基础。 理解:Object类型是所有它的实例的基础,换句话说,Object类型所具有的任何属性
25KB
JavaScript判断数组是否存在key的简单实例
2020-12-09JS中复合数组associative array和对象是等同的,判断一个key是否存在于数组中(或对象是否包含某个属性),不能使用ary == undefined,因为可能存在ary = {key:u
30KB
用jQuery将JavaScript对象转换为querystring查询字符串的方法
2020-12-01在get方式的参数传递中,常常需要将JavaScript对象,转换成查询字符串,比如: { method: 'get', state: '200' } 会转换成 ?method=get&state=2
69KB
Js中使用hasOwnProperty方法检索ajax响应对象的例子
2020-10-25主要介绍了Js中使用hasOwnProperty方法检索ajax响应对象的例子,本文介绍的技巧就是hasOwnProperty方法在ajax请求中的使用,需要的朋友可以参考下
26KB
javascript检测对象中是否存在某个属性判断方法小结
2020-12-07检测对象中属性的存在与否可以通过几种方法来判断。 1.使用in关键字该方法可以判断对象的自有属性和继承来的属性是否存在。 代码如下: var o={x:1}; “x” in o; //true,自有属
29KB
浅谈js使用in和hasOwnProperty获取对象属性的区别
2020-12-11in判断的是对象的所有属性,包括对象实例及其原型的属性; 而hasOwnProperty则是判断对象实例的是否具有某个属性。 示例代码: function Person(){ } Person.pro
25KB
JavaScript对象属性检查、增加、删除、访问操作实例
2020-12-12检查属性 var mouse = { "name": "betta", "age": 3, "varieties": "milaoshu" } mouse.hasOwnProperty("name")
51KB
JS中的hasOwnProperty()和isPrototypeOf()属性实例详解
2020-11-26这两个属性都是Object.prototype所提供:Object.prototype.hasOwnProperty()和Object.prototype.isPropertyOf() 先讲解hasO
20KB
JavaScript获得指定对象大小的方法
2020-12-09本文实例讲述了JavaScript获得指定对象大小的方法。分享给大家供大家参考。具体如下: function objectSize(the_object) { /* function to valid
高并发下的Nginx性能优化实战
2019-12-24【超实用课程内容】 本课程内容包含讲解解读Nginx的基础知识,解读Nginx的核心知识、带领学员进行高并发环境下的Nginx性能优化实战,让学生能够快速将所学融合到企业应用中。 【课程如何观看?】 PC端:https://edu.csdn.net/course/detail/27216 移动端:CSDN 学院APP(注意不是CSDN APP哦) 本课程为录播课,课程永久有效观看时长,大家可以抓紧时间学习后一起讨论哦~ 【学员专享增值服务】 源码开放 课件、课程案例代码完全开放给你,你可以根据所学知识,自行修改、优化 下载方式:电脑登录https://edu.csdn.net/course/detail/27216,播放页面右侧点击课件进行资料打包下载
python入门
2018-12-18您观看课程学习后 免费入群领取【超全Python资料包+17本学习电子书】 帮助与数百万年轻人打开人工智能的学习大门!
Python进阶-Pandas数据分析库
2018-12-18您观看课程学习后 免费入群领取【超全Python资料包+17本学习电子书】 Pandas是python中非常常用的数据分析库,在数据分析,机器学习,深度学习等领域经常被使用。本课程会讲解到pandas中最核心的一些知识点,包括Series以及DataFrame的构建,赋值,操作,选择数据,合并等等,以及使用pandas对文件进行读取和写入,使用pandas绘图等等。
JAVA入门精品课程
2018-12-20课程目标: 1、让初学者从小白开始,善于运用知识点,解脱学习的苦恼 2、能够学习更多的工作中使用技巧,成为编程高手
Java系列技术之JavaWeb入门
2018-09-18JavaWeb里的基础核心技术
-
下载
面试资料汇总(必会).docx
面试资料汇总(必会).docx
-
学院
FFmpeg4.3系列之26:视频监控之H265多路摄像头播控项目实战
FFmpeg4.3系列之26:视频监控之H265多路摄像头播控项目实战
-
博客
深入理解mongoose
深入理解mongoose
-
博客
算法:kmp算法
算法:kmp算法
-
博客
2021年美容师(中级)考试报名及美容师(中级)考试总结
2021年美容师(中级)考试报名及美容师(中级)考试总结
-
学院
Excel高级图表技巧
Excel高级图表技巧
-
博客
炼丹(AI、人工智障)环境搭建
炼丹(AI、人工智障)环境搭建
-
下载
VB6环境获取物理网卡信息
VB6环境获取物理网卡信息
-
博客
记录一下几个HTTP HEADER字段
记录一下几个HTTP HEADER字段
-
博客
数据结构 线性表(线性表的链式表示)C语言实现
数据结构 线性表(线性表的链式表示)C语言实现
-
下载
华为荣耀9青春(HI6250V100方案)原厂原理图维修图(PDF格式)
华为荣耀9青春(HI6250V100方案)原厂原理图维修图(PDF格式)
-
博客
Hertz‘s fall——尚硅谷Java学习的心路历程
Hertz‘s fall——尚硅谷Java学习的心路历程
-
下载
COM开发中的uuid,GUID,CLSID,ProgID区别在哪儿.zip
COM开发中的uuid,GUID,CLSID,ProgID区别在哪儿.zip
-
博客
Linux学习之旅--7
Linux学习之旅--7
-
博客
用豪斯霍尔德(Householder)变换进行矩阵的QR分解,及其Matlab和OpenCV实现
用豪斯霍尔德(Householder)变换进行矩阵的QR分解,及其Matlab和OpenCV实现
-
学院
【数据分析-随到随学】数据分析建模和预测
【数据分析-随到随学】数据分析建模和预测
-
学院
计算机网络基础
计算机网络基础
-
博客
react——通过creatRef来创建ref标识
react——通过creatRef来创建ref标识
-
博客
机器学习基本概念
机器学习基本概念
-
学院
电商设计专业思维
电商设计专业思维
-
博客
一篇文章带你看懂Qt MVC(模型、视图、代理)编程————附带详细图文和代码
一篇文章带你看懂Qt MVC(模型、视图、代理)编程————附带详细图文和代码
-
学院
前端架构师-速成
前端架构师-速成
-
下载
Lua 参考手册 5.3.epub
Lua 参考手册 5.3.epub
-
学院
【数据分析-随到随学】SPSS调查问卷统计分析
【数据分析-随到随学】SPSS调查问卷统计分析
-
学院
thinkphp5.1博客后台实战视频
thinkphp5.1博客后台实战视频
-
下载
Lua 参考手册 5.3.azw3
Lua 参考手册 5.3.azw3
-
学院
JavaEE框架(Maven+SSM)全程实战开发教程(源码+讲义)
JavaEE框架(Maven+SSM)全程实战开发教程(源码+讲义)
-
学院
python数据分析基础
python数据分析基础
-
下载
神经网络与深度学习双语均在.7z
神经网络与深度学习双语均在.7z
-
博客
公式计算 、if语句 、switch语句, 选择结构例题, if 、else if 、else 的正确使用,温度转换、分段函数求值、成绩评定题型 ,新手编程入门 基础巩固学习C语言 习题
公式计算 、if语句 、switch语句, 选择结构例题, if 、else if 、else 的正确使用,温度转换、分段函数求值、成绩评定题型 ,新手编程入门 基础巩固学习C语言 习题